Trackman is a fast-growing sports technology company that develops, manufactures, and sells 3D ball flight measurement systems for a variety of sports verticals. Originally developed for golf, Trackman now enjoys a market leader position in several sports disciplines in measuring and delivering real-time sports motion data.
